I run the car on the road and on the track. My first option was to go for TKO600 and run a 3.31. Then I found that quicktime where making a bellhousing to take the TUET 1806 t56 viper box. With a .50 6th and 3.54 gears I can run 70mph at 1600rpm and have the 3.54 diff for mind blowing accelaration in the lower gears or should I just stick to the TKO 600 also thinking of running an aluminium flywheel and a McCleod twin plate clutch
